I'll share photos of my wonderful day in the Lido, but first: Bar Pasticceria di Chiusso Pierino, a perfect place in which to begin and end a perfect day and the place that is taking the top spot in our Bakeries & Pastry Shops section. As the name implies, it's a bar and a pastry shop. But it's more! It is one of the best pasticceria in Venice no doubt. Neighbors argue over which brioche to buy on Sunday morning, not whether to go somewhere else. And, evening spritz are served with house-made croutons rather than potato chips. What can I say about the food there? Well, my rule is to go places twice before making up my mind about putting them in the guide. But I've been here five times in the past two days and I'm already subconsciously trying to invent a route from San Francesco Della Vigna to Rialto that will take me past there this evening. A Venetian will recognize that that is a route that makes no sense whatsoever, but this place might actually be that good!
